Output 43c16879efe5bf8272c47feffb08d3a4b5c20410383ea8cd9af0c7edd5cfd0e5:23

value
59811776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c5cb2568f776076ba043ee1eed18a8ee2890b20 OP_EQUALVERIFY OP_CHECKSIG
address
FZDHE2S2VAo8TuENmXwFUyHsLd5edjxnNK
transaction
43c16879efe5bf8272c47feffb08d3a4b5c20410383ea8cd9af0c7edd5cfd0e5